On the beaches of L'Espiguette, the loveliest beaches of the French Mediterranean, you can enjoy the delights of doing nothing: sunbathing and swimming in the sea. There are lots of water sports available in the resort of Grau du Roi/Port Camargue. And 10 minutes away, there's kitesurfing, paddleboarding, windsurfing, and so much more - see www.windsurf-park.com
This is above all a fishing village... You'll love being there when the fishing boats come in, and buying the freshly-caught fish.
You'll discover the Camargue, all of which you'll find compelling. A regional nature reserve where you can set off on horseback and watch the white horses, black bulls and pink flamingos.
In Aigues-Mortes, you'll explore the city surrounded by its 13th-century ramparts, many restaurants and picturesque shops.
A little further afield, some towns of character: Roman Nîmes, Montpellier and Arles, not forgetting the Pont du Gard, Uzès and its duchy, Anduze as well as the magic of the Cévennes, while major cultural events enliven the summer months in the Languedoc Roussillon.
